“I would have played in the Dutch cricket team had it not been for the fact that the Dutch coaching staff decided to bend the rules, act against the spirit of cricket and basically cheat”

Netherlands batsman Tim Gruijters has revealed that the team management claimed that he had an injury in order to add all-rounder Tom Cooper into the country’s World Twenty20 squad.

“At the end of the day, even if there is a small crack there and my symptoms aren’t painful, I see no reason why I can’t continue to play”

England pace bowler Stuart Broad is unlikely to play in the Boxing Day Test after being hit on the right foot by Australia left-arm pace bowler Mitchell Johnson during the third day of the third Test in Perth.
